About MCB Group
Corporate Philosophy
Founded in 1838, the Mauritius Commercial Bank Limited (MCB) has cemented its positioning as the leading bank in Mauritius and a key financial services institution in sub-Saharan Africa.
True to its vision and mission, the MCB wields a sound business model to successfully consolidate its domestic banking operations and concomitantly pursue its sensible diversification strategy by tapping into the potential of non-bank financial and investment services but also establishing a stronger foothold beyond local shores, notably in regional markets.
Cognisant of ever-evolving market exigencies, the MCB has, throughout its history, crafted bold strategies which have grown business on the back of well-anticipated opportunities and threats, an unwavering dedication to excellent customer service, continuous business process improvement and a knowledgeable and motivated workforce.
Reflective of its corporate philosophy and anchored on its core values of
Integrity, Customer Care, Teamwork, Knowledge, Innovation and Excellence
, the MCB also has a tradition of being a pioneer in adapting to a demanding operating environment, through ongoing business innovations and the introduction of state-of-the-art, quicker, cheaper and more comprehensive services to the satisfaction of its increasingly sophisticated customers domestically and internationally. Consequently, the MCB Group continues to be trusted by its stakeholders for fulfilling its brand promise every day and for upholding high standards of corporate governance, employee diversity, social responsibility and environmental protection.
Going forward, the MCB Group, propped up by the three pillars of excellent customer service experience which are people, processes and technology, is well geared towards furthering its strategic orientation of evolving into a one-stop shop in financial services locally and in the region, whilst continuing to generate real and sustainable value for all its stakeholders and catalysing the socio-economic prosperity of Mauritius.
